Default Yamaha Gas G19 vs 2012 G29?

I'm buying my 1st cart. I have found 2 Yamaha gas carts. G19 for $2600 or 2012 G29 for about $3200. I have property on 2 sides of the road I run back and forth over while hauling items for the waterfront side. Also landscaping tools, chain saw, trimmers, coolers. Was told gas is the way to go. I have read the G29 might not be the way to go? I plan on adding rear fold down seat, 3" left with bigger tires. Any thoughts on which cart? Thanks in advance for any shared thoughts!

Yamaha G19's are electric, so not a comparison really. The question is...is the G29 a 2012 or 2012.5. 2012.5's had the better upgraded clutch's and pedal assemblies.

The likely actual model of the older one is a G16a, since G19 is electric only. G16a was a good, tough cart.
